Avalanche Food Group – LinkedIn
Avalanche Food Group. Restaurants. Sugar Land, Texas 83 followers. Creating memorable experiences through our commitment to personalized, exceptional …
Building "Bridges" Across the Bayou City!
Avalanche Food Group. Restaurants. Sugar Land, Texas 83 followers. Creating memorable experiences through our commitment to personalized, exceptional …